1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does a drop in air pressure typically indicate about the weather?
Back
A drop in air pressure typically indicates that the weather will be cloudy with a chance of rain.
Tags
NGSS.MS-ESS2-5
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What type of air pressure is associated with clear skies?
Back
High pressure is associated with clear skies.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What weather conditions are expected during a high pressure system?
Back
Clear and sunny weather conditions are expected during a high pressure system.
Tags
NGSS.MS-ESS2-5
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What happens when an area of high pressure is near an area of low pressure?
Back
Winds at high speeds are likely to occur when an area of high pressure is near an area of low pressure.
Tags
NGSS.MS-ESS2-5
NGSS.MS-ESS2-6
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What kind of weather is associated with a low pressure system?
Back
A low pressure system is typically associated with rainy and windy weather.
Tags
NGSS.MS-ESS2-5
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Define high pressure in meteorological terms.
Back
High pressure refers to an area where the atmospheric pressure is greater than that of the surrounding areas, often leading to clear and calm weather.
Tags
NGSS.MS-ESS2-5
NGSS.MS-ESS2-6
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Define low pressure in meteorological terms.
Back
Low pressure refers to an area where the atmospheric pressure is lower than that of the surrounding areas, often leading to cloudy and stormy weather.
Tags
NGSS.MS-ESS2-5
NGSS.MS-ESS2-6
